Srinivas Reddy (www.srinivasreddy.org) Srinivas Reddy is an Indian-American sitarist, guitarist and composer. In 1998 he came under the tutelage of Sri Partha Chatterjee, a direct disciple of the late sitar maestro Pandit Nikhil Banerjee. Since then Srinivas has rigorously trained with his teacher in the traditional guru-shishya style. Srinivas is a professional concert sitarist and has given numerous recitals in the US and India. He is also an experienced teacher and educator, he holds a BA from Brown University, an MA from UC Berkeley, and is currently teaching at UMass Dartmouth.
Sameer Gupta (www.sameergupta.com) Founder of the critically acclaimed SF based improvisational ensemble The Supplicants, Sameer Gupta is an original musical voice in jazz, world, and fusion music. He has studied percussion for most of his life, beginning in Tokyo, Japan in 1985. Since then Sameer has performed on jazz drumset at Lincoln Center, tabla at Asagiri Jam in Japan and various Jazz and World music festivals across the nation and abroad. Sameer began his study of North Indian classical tabla in 2002 and is currently studying with tabla master Pandit Anindo Chatterjee.
The Tollywood Allstars (www.tollywoodallstars.com) Formed in “Tollywood”, the film district in Kolkata, India, The Tollywood Allstars are a groundbreaking Latin-Indian fusion band. The Tollywood Allstars are a collective of musicians with sound backgrounds from around the world fused together into an unique acoustic sound. Influenced by Indian Classical, South American and Cuban music, The Tollywood Allstars have a distinctly original flavor, authentically combining moods, subtleties and rhythms.

myspace.com/neelmurgai After being a side man in such groups as Mission: on Mars and Dhafuzion for years, Neel Murgai is now presenting his own unique vision. This ensemble combines Neel’s sitar with the downtown stylings of viola player Mat Maneri, along with Sameer Gupta on tabla and Greg Heffernan on cello. This indo-chamber jazz group performs a new kind of music that combines Indian melody and rhythm, with experimental compositional techniques, orchestral textures and free improvisation. Their sound ranges from droning minimalism as Neel uses his overtone singing techniques, to intricate arrangements, mathematical rhythmic structures and ecstatic flights of fancy. Imagine Ravi Shankar meeting Bartok while listening to John Coltrane.
